I love this poem. I found a picture frame at Hallmark two years ago with this poem and a spot for a picture. Since my Dh is a SAHD it seemed like the perfect gift for him:
Walk with me daddy
Author: unknown
Walk alongside me, daddy
and hold my little hand.
I have so many things to learn
that I don't yet understand.
Teach me things to keep me safe
from dangers every day.
Show me how to do my best
at home, at school, at play.
Every child needs a gentle hand
to guide them as they grow.
So walk alongside me, daddy -
We have a long way to go.

A quote that was on a fathers day card that my son made at daycare.
The teachers dipped his foot in paint and made a foot print and included this saying:
Footprints
"Walk a little slower daddy" said a child so
small. "I'm following in your footsteps and
I don't want to fall.
Sometimes you steps are very fast,
Sometimes they're hard to see;
So walk a little slower, Daddy,
For you are leading me.
Someday when I'm all grown up
You're what I want to be;
Them I will hava a little child
Who'll want to follow me.
And I would want to lead just right,
And know that I was true;
So, Walk a little slower, Daddy
For I must follow you."
